You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@hbase.apache.org by "kaushik mandal (Jira)" <ji...@apache.org> on 2022/11/24 14:18:00 UTC

[jira] [Created] (HBASE-27508) Hbase master is not up due to NotServingRegionException: hbase:meta,,1 is not online

kaushik mandal created HBASE-27508:
--------------------------------------

             Summary: Hbase master is not up due to NotServingRegionException: hbase:meta,,1 is not online
                 Key: HBASE-27508
                 URL: https://issues.apache.org/jira/browse/HBASE-27508
             Project: HBase
          Issue Type: Bug
    Affects Versions: 2.4.13
         Environment: we are using 

hbase 2.4.13 and hdfs 3.3.0
            Reporter: kaushik mandal


Hbase master is in initializing state and never become ready.

it is not up due to following error

"NotServingRegionException: hbase:meta,,1 is not online on hbase-regionserver-0.hbase-regionserver.default.svc.cluster.local, ..."

when we observe this:

when region server split into multiple region and there is restart of hbase regionserver and master.
{code:java}
INFO  [main] util.HBaseFsck: Validating mapping using HDFS state
Number of live region servers: 1
Number of dead region servers: 2
Master: hbase-master-0.hbase-master.default.svc.cluster.local,....
Number of backup masters: 0
Average load: 0.0
Number of requests: 0 
Number of regions: 0
Number of regions in transition: 0
INFO  [main] client.RpcRetryingCallerImpl: Call exception, tries=6, retries=16, started=4333 ms ago, cancelled=false, msg=org.apache.hadoop.hbase.PleaseHoldException: Master is initializing
    at org.apache.hadoop.hbase.master.HMaster.checkInitialized(HMaster.java:2830)
    at org.apache.hadoop.hbase.master.MasterRpcServices.getTableDescriptors(MasterRpcServices.java:1075)
    at org.apache.hadoop.hbase.shaded.protobuf.generated.MasterProtos$MasterService$2.callBlockingMethod(MasterProtos.java)
    at org.apache.hadoop.hbase.ipc.RpcServer.call(RpcServer.java:384)
    at org.apache.hadoop.hbase.ipc.CallRunner.run(CallRunner.java:131)
    at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run(RpcExecutor.java:371)
    at org.apache.hadoop.hbase.ipc.RpcExecutor$Handler.run(RpcExecutor.java:351)
, details=, see https://s.apache.org/timeout {code}
workaround:

to make it up, we are deleting /hbase/meta-regionserver using "hbase zkcli delete   /hbase/meta-regionserver"

 

is there any way to prevent this to occur by setting some properties in hbase-site.xml 



--
This message was sent by Atlassian Jira
(v8.20.10#820010)